This webinar focuses on tips you need to know to work with sheet metal flat …To create a flat pattern configuration: In a sheet metal part, create a new configuration. In the FeatureManager design tree, do one of the following: Right-click Flat-Pattern and select Unsuppress . Select Process-Bends and all of the features after it. Click Edit > Suppress > This Configuration to suppress all of the selected features.The terms "fixed rate" and "flat rate" sound interchangeable in nature but, in fact, are not. Imagine a cone without its base made out of paper. You then roll it out, so it lies flat on a table.You will get a shape like the one in the diagram above. It is a part (or a sector) of a larger circle whose radius (l) is equal to the slant height of the cone.The arc length of the sector (c) is equivalent to the circumference of the cone base.By combining …With a single body sheet metal part open, on the ribbon click Sheet Metal tab Flat Pattern panel , click Create Flat Pattern. Use the Flat Pattern tool to automatically create a flattened version of a sheet metal part and prepare the model for manufacture. The Flat Pattern feature remains the last feature in the Model Tree and maintains the flat model view.
